Transaction 6699088e94e74337acce3e8cf69f47e2a23305c82e108a2a9bf20ecc99dae350
1 Input
1 Output
-
6699088e94e74337acce3e8cf69f47e2a23305c82e108a2a9bf20ecc99dae350:0
- value
- 295183
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b6ae78b9689ca7071371b89d8c5d5f0c1f47899 OP_EQUALVERIFY OP_CHECKSIG
- address
- 123NVxsA8bHso56iNLWVxJeAkzufqmimxb